NETGEAR has launched a public bug bounty program with Bugcrowd to improve the security of its products and stay ahead of emerging threats.` The company is committed to protecting user data and privacy by being proactive in its approach to security, adding a managed bug bounty program as part of its efforts.` The scope of the program includes NETGEAR's devices, mobile applications, and exposed APIs, with potential rewards ranging from Bugcrowd points to $15,000 per identified bug.` By participating in the program, security researchers can contribute to enhancing the company's security posture.
